Unveiling Chrome’s Tab Innovations
To access these game-changing features, follow these simple steps:
- Launch Chrome on your Android device.
- Tap the three-dot menu in the upper-right corner and select “Settings.”
- Scroll down to find the “Tabs” section under the “Advanced” header.
- Discover the two new tab treasures awaiting you.
Automated Tab Management
By tapping “Inactive,” you can customize how Chrome handles inactive tabs:
– Define inactivity thresholds of seven, 14, or 21 days.
– Automatically group duplicate tabs into an “Inactive tabs” area.
– Choose to close tabs inactive for 60 days.
Seamless Cross-Device Tab Groups
Another exciting feature is the ability to automatically open tab groups from other devices on your Android device. Imagine starting a tab group on your computer and having it effortlessly appear on your phone. Convenience at its finest!
